I was on meds for GERD (GastroEsophagealRefluxDisease). My hiatal hernia was repaired when I was banded and my surgeon stopped the 2 meds I was on for that then. He also stopped my arthritis meds because it's a NSAID and can cause stomach problems. I monitored my blood pressure at home and when it dropped I called my primary care physician. He had my take half the dose, then a few days later cut that in half then discontinued it. I just have to monitor it occasionally. I am also now off my asthma meds.
